| #include "cc/metrics/compositor_frame_reporting_controller.h" |
| |
| #include "base/macros.h" |
| #include "base/test/metrics/histogram_tester.h" |
| #include "components/viz/common/frame_timing_details.h" |
| #include "components/viz/common/quads/compositor_frame_metadata.h" |
| #include "testing/gtest/include/gtest/gtest.h" |
| |
| namespace cc { |
| namespace { |
| |
| class CompositorFrameReportingControllerTest; |
| |
| class TestCompositorFrameReportingController |
| : public CompositorFrameReportingController { |
| public: |
| TestCompositorFrameReportingController( |
| CompositorFrameReportingControllerTest* test) |
| : CompositorFrameReportingController(), test_(test) {} |
| |
| TestCompositorFrameReportingController( |
| const TestCompositorFrameReportingController& controller) = delete; |
| |
| TestCompositorFrameReportingController& operator=( |
| const TestCompositorFrameReportingController& controller) = delete; |
| |
| std::unique_ptr<CompositorFrameReporter>* reporters() { return reporters_; } |
| |
| int ActiveReporters() { |
| int count = 0; |
| for (int i = 0; i < PipelineStage::kNumPipelineStages; ++i) { |
| if (reporters_[i]) |
| ++count; |
| } |
| return count; |
| } |
| |
| protected: |
| CompositorFrameReportingControllerTest* test_; |
| }; |
| |
| class CompositorFrameReportingControllerTest : public testing::Test { |
| public: |
| CompositorFrameReportingControllerTest() : reporting_controller_(this) {} |
| |
| // The following functions simulate the actions that would |
| // occur for each phase of the reporting controller. |
| void SimulateBeginImplFrame() { reporting_controller_.WillBeginImplFrame(); } |
| |
| void SimulateBeginMainFrame() { |
| if (!reporting_controller_.reporters()[CompositorFrameReportingController:: |
| PipelineStage::kBeginImplFrame]) |
| SimulateBeginImplFrame(); |
| CHECK( |
| reporting_controller_.reporters()[CompositorFrameReportingController:: |
| PipelineStage::kBeginImplFrame]); |
| reporting_controller_.WillBeginMainFrame(); |
| } |
| |
| void SimulateCommit(std::unique_ptr<BeginMainFrameMetrics> blink_breakdown) { |
| if (!reporting_controller_.reporters()[CompositorFrameReportingController:: |
| PipelineStage::kBeginMainFrame]) |
| SimulateBeginMainFrame(); |
| CHECK( |
| reporting_controller_.reporters()[CompositorFrameReportingController:: |
| PipelineStage::kBeginMainFrame]); |
| reporting_controller_.SetBlinkBreakdown(std::move(blink_breakdown)); |
| reporting_controller_.WillCommit(); |
| reporting_controller_.DidCommit(); |
| } |
| |
| void SimulateActivate() { |
| if (!reporting_controller_.reporters() |
| [CompositorFrameReportingController::PipelineStage::kCommit]) |
| SimulateCommit(nullptr); |
| CHECK(reporting_controller_.reporters() |
| [CompositorFrameReportingController::PipelineStage::kCommit]); |
| reporting_controller_.WillActivate(); |
| reporting_controller_.DidActivate(); |
| } |
| |
| void SimulateSubmitCompositorFrame(uint32_t frame_token) { |
| if (!reporting_controller_.reporters() |
| [CompositorFrameReportingController::PipelineStage::kActivate]) |
| SimulateActivate(); |
| CHECK(reporting_controller_.reporters() |
| [CompositorFrameReportingController::PipelineStage::kActivate]); |
| reporting_controller_.DidSubmitCompositorFrame(frame_token); |
| } |
| |
| void SimulatePresentCompositorFrame() { |
| ++next_token_; |
| SimulateSubmitCompositorFrame(*next_token_); |
| viz::FrameTimingDetails details = {}; |
| details.presentation_feedback.timestamp = base::TimeTicks::Now(); |
| reporting_controller_.DidPresentCompositorFrame(*next_token_, details); |
| } |
| |
| protected: |
| TestCompositorFrameReportingController reporting_controller_; |
| |
| private: |
| viz::FrameTokenGenerator next_token_; |
| }; |
| |
| TEST_F(CompositorFrameReportingControllerTest, ActiveReporterCounts) { |
| // Check that there are no leaks with the CompositorFrameReporter |
| // objects no matter what the sequence of scheduled actions is |
| // Note that due to DCHECKs in WillCommit(), WillActivate(), etc., it |
| // is impossible to have 2 reporters both in BMF or Commit |
| |
| // Tests Cases: |
| // - 2 Reporters at Activate phase |
| // - 2 back-to-back BeginImplFrames |
| // - 4 Simultaneous Reporters |
| |
| // BF |
| reporting_controller_.WillBeginImplFrame(); |
| EXPECT_EQ(1, reporting_controller_.ActiveReporters()); |
| |
| // BF -> BF |
| // Should replace previous reporter. |
| reporting_controller_.WillBeginImplFrame(); |
| EXPECT_EQ(1, reporting_controller_.ActiveReporters()); |
| |
| // BF -> BMF -> BF |
| // Should add new reporter. |
| reporting_controller_.WillBeginMainFrame(); |
| reporting_controller_.WillBeginImplFrame(); |
| EXPECT_EQ(2, reporting_controller_.ActiveReporters()); |
| |
| // BF -> BMF -> BF -> Commit |
| // Should stay same. |
| reporting_controller_.WillCommit(); |
| reporting_controller_.DidCommit(); |
| EXPECT_EQ(2, reporting_controller_.ActiveReporters()); |
| |
| // BF -> BMF -> BF -> Commit -> BMF -> Activate -> Commit -> Activation |
| // Having two reporters at Activate phase should delete the older one. |
| reporting_controller_.WillBeginMainFrame(); |
| reporting_controller_.WillActivate(); |
| reporting_controller_.DidActivate(); |
| reporting_controller_.WillCommit(); |
| reporting_controller_.DidCommit(); |
| reporting_controller_.WillActivate(); |
| reporting_controller_.DidActivate(); |
| EXPECT_EQ(1, reporting_controller_.ActiveReporters()); |
| |
| reporting_controller_.DidSubmitCompositorFrame(0); |
| EXPECT_EQ(0, reporting_controller_.ActiveReporters()); |
| |
| // 4 simultaneous reporters active. |
| SimulateActivate(); |
| |
| SimulateCommit(nullptr); |
| |
| SimulateBeginMainFrame(); |
| |
| SimulateBeginImplFrame(); |
| EXPECT_EQ(4, reporting_controller_.ActiveReporters()); |
| |
| // Any additional BeginImplFrame's would be ignored. |
| SimulateBeginImplFrame(); |
| EXPECT_EQ(4, reporting_controller_.ActiveReporters()); |
| } |
